A New Microsoft Platform in Town: the Microsoft Intelligent Data Platform Recently Microsoft introduced a new platform called the Microsoft Intelligent Data Platform that fully integrates their database, analytics, and governance offerings. The new platform encompasses everything already available in the Azure Data space (Azure...
GitHub - ory/kratos: Next-gen identity server (think Auth0, Okta, Firebase) with Ory-hardened authentication, MFA, FIDO2, profile management, identity schemas, social sign in, registration, account recovery, passwordless. Golang, headless, API-only - without templating or theming headaches. Available as a cloud service. Next-gen identity server (think Auth0, Okta, Firebase) with Ory-hardened authentication, MFA, FIDO2, profile management, identity schemas, social sign in, registration, account recovery, passwordle...
I resurrected my Dutch movie review site from 2003 Between 2003 and 2006, I ran a Dutch movie review site called moevie.nl.1 I built the site and wrote the reviews. It never made any money. It cost me money to host, and it cost me a lot of time writing reviews, but I remember enjoying writing reviews abou...
What Makes a Good Research Proposal? Research is rarely quick: it takes time, people, and (in most cases) equipment to complete. To convince those in control of the purse strings that we should be given the necessary resources to tackle a research problem, we create a research proposal. This...
Microsoft Build – Join us May 24-26 2022 Come together and discover the latest innovations in code and application development—and gain insights from peers and experts from around the world.
20 Years of SIP - a Retrospective June of 2022 marks the twentieth anniversary – yes – TWENTIETH – of the publication of the Session Initiation Protocol (SIP), documented in RFC 3261 . When it was published in June of 2002, it...
The Universe of Discourse : Disabling the awful Macbook screen lock key Disabling the awful Macbook screen lock key
Using Postgres Schemas | Aaron O. Ellis Schemas are a shockingly underappreciated feature of relational databases. With minimal overhead, they enable segmentation and isolation of tables within a database.
Cranelift, Part 4: A New Register Allocator This post is the fourth part of a three-part series1 describing work that I have been doing to improve the Cranelift compiler. In this post, I’ll describe the work that went into regalloc2, a new register allocator I developed over the past year. The allo...
.NET DC June: Jon Galloway Presents "What’s new in ASP.NET Core with .NET 6 & 7", Tue, Jun 21, 2022, 6:00 PM | Meetup Tue, Jun 21, 6:00 PM EDT: **Streaming in 3 Places for your convenience!** * [YouTube](https://www.youtube.com/watch?v=3kBuM9I1q2M) * [LinkedIn](https://www.linkedin.com/feed/update/urn:li:ugcPost:6
Why are nuclear power construction costs so high? Part I Nuclear power currently makes up slightly less than 20% of the total electricity produced in the US, largely from plants built in the 70s and 80s. People are often enthusiastic about greater use of nuclear power as a potential strategy for decarbonizing e...
Twitter, Coinbase, and other companies are rescinding lucrative job offers as a cost-cutting strategy instead of the usual mix of layoffs and slower backfills By Emily Peck / Axios. View the full context on Techmeme.
GitHub Killing Atom Code Editor for Cloud Tools -- Visual Studio Magazine Microsoft-owned GitHub announced it will sunset its popular Atom 'hackable text editor' late this year as it concentrates on cloud-based dev tooling.
.NET 7 Preview 5 - Generic Math .NET 7 Preview 5 includes significant improvements to the Generic Math feature.
Duende Software We help companies using .NET to build identity and access control solutions for modern applications.
Microsoft identity platform overview - Microsoft Entra Learn about the components of the Microsoft identity platform and how they can help you build identity and access management (IAM) support into your applications.
Introduction to Identity on ASP.NET Core Use Identity with an ASP.NET Core app. Learn how to set password requirements (RequireDigit, RequiredLength, RequiredUniqueChars, and more).
New Profiler feature in Visual Studio Introducing the new File I/O tool We just launched a new profiling tool in Visual Studio 17.2 that helps you understand how you can optimize your File I/O operations to improve performance in your apps. If you’re trying to investigate and diagnose slow l...
Code Review: How to make enemies | RepoHealth Sometimes people at work annoy you, and you feel like you need to get your own back. Make them pay for the imaginary slights they've committed against you. Often there isn't really a way. But if you work in software development. Then there is always a way...
What's OpenIddict? OpenIddict aims at providing a versatile solution to implement an OpenID Connect server and token validation in any ASP.NET Core 2.1 (and higher) application. ASP.NET 4.6.1 (and higher) applications are also fully supported thanks to a native Microsoft.Ow...
This project is on hold · Discussion #689 · aaubry/YamlDotNet After a long time without touching this repository, I came to the conclusion that I no longer have the will to work on it. This is a free time project and lately I want to spend that time on other ...
High performance .NET: Building a Redis Clone–Analysis In the previous post, I wrote a small Redis clone using the most naïve manner. It was able to hit nearly 1M queries per second on our test instance...
Stop Interviewing With Leet Code During interviews, technical skills in the industry are still largely vetted through LeetCode-style questions. These are small algorithmic riddles in the for...
A new portal for Project Galileo participants To provide Galileo participants with one place to access resources, configuration tips, product explainers, and more, we built the Cloudflare Social Impact Projects Portal
50th Anniversary of The Mother of All Demos I was asked to give a toast in celebration of the 50th Anniversary of [The Mother of All Demos](https://en.wikipedia.org/wiki/The_Mother_of_All_Demos) so I spent some time reflecting on Engelbart's w...
How to Mock the File System for Unit Testing in .NET - Code Maze In this article, we are going to learn how to Mock the File System for Unit Testing in .NET. Of course, we'll see how to unit test it as well.
Setting session affinity (services) | Cloud Run Documentation | Google Cloud This page shows how to enable session affinity for your Cloud Run service revision.
r/dotnet - Does anyone else feel as lost as I do in the .NET Identity documentation? 190 votes and 107 comments so far on Reddit
Webinar: Diving Into Unity – A Quick Start for C# Developers | The .NET Tools Blog Join us Tuesday, June 21, 2022, 15:00 - 16:00 UTC (check other timezones) for our free live webinar, Diving Into Unity - A Quick Start for C# Developers with Author, Developer, and Team Lead, Andrew S
Does anyone else feel as lost as I do in the .NET Identity documentation? (I mean this, and all things related to it: https://docs.microsoft.com/en-us/aspnet/core/security/authentication/?view=aspnetcore-6.0 Or this:...
Maybe it's time to rethink our project structure with .NET 6 Challenging the status quo with some thoughts on the new .NET Minimal Web API to keep code simple
A bigger piece of the pi: Finding the 100-trillionth digit In 2019, Googler Emma Haruka Iwao broke the Pi record — and now she’s done it again.
Does anyone else feel as lost as I do in the .NET Identity documentation? : dotnet (I mean this, and all things related to it: https://docs.microsoft.com/en-us/aspnet/core/security/authentication/?view=aspnetcore-6.0
Does anyone else feel as lost as I do in the .NET Identity documentation? : dotnet (I mean this, and all things related to it: https://docs.microsoft.com/en-us/aspnet/core/security/authentication/?view=aspnetcore-6.0
Architecture is Medium My 3 year old daughter has a hankering, yes, a hankering for the song “Let it Go”. Keep in mind, it’s 2022, and the original Frozen came out in 2012; but to her, every day is R…
Microsoft Build – Join us May 24-26 2022 Come together and discover the latest innovations in code and application development—and gain insights from peers and experts from around the world.
How to use variables in CSS with v-bind in VueJs 3 - Zelig880 Unclutter your code of hacks and learn how to use dynamic variables in your CSS using the new feature "v-bind in CSS" available in Vue 3.
Achieve Day-One Productivity for New Engineers Your newly hired engineer shouldn’t take a week to get ramped up. Onboarding is one of your most important jobs as an engineering manager. If you get it right, day-one productivity is very possible.
Hackertab, 1 Year after launch 🎂, 2 Million page views, $2000 in revenue, $0 Marketing... Almost one year ago, I launched Hackertab, a browser extension that allows developers to stay up-to-date with the latest tech happenings in an easy way, the tool gatters articles, tutorials, repositories, jobs, events… and filter them by users interests. ...
Being a solopreneur (part 1) Follow these principles when it comes to zero-party data collection on your Shopify store.
You are allowed to invent HTTP status codes | Swizec Teller A fun problem for RESTful APIs: Did you get 404 because your URL is wrong or because the resource wasn't found?
The most big problem of UI kits UI kits are became popular and today exists really many UI libraries, but almost whole its a have one fundamental architecture problem which make this libraries not much good for wide use. The problem is a not modular design.
Complicated software is required to evolution Last time i often hear point about "modern software is unjustified complicated compared to software of 20-30 years ago, modern development approach is wrong and we must focus on performance and energy efficient" and i completely against of this point. Com...